Deviant Love

This is an incredibly short story I wrote for my A-Level Literature course and like the majority of my poetry it has resurfaced lately...

Age would have broken you and torn you from beauty's path, so for my gift to you I give you beauteous death.
I drink you in as the sweet perfume of death fills me and explodes my senses. Your arms tighten around me like a lovers knot as you tear into me, trying to regain some of your self.
Sated, I leave you, semi-naked and weeping as you ebb away slowly.
A kiss my love? You beckon me close again and I join with you until your last breath sighs from your body.
As I leave your moon kissed form I think of my immortality and wish I were with you. Instead I turn, ever hungry,out into the night, my one true love.
The scent of innocence excites like an erotic fantasy, so I chase it through these dead and broken streets into my next lovers arms.
